Skip to main content

Testing approximate symmetry in the plane is NP-hard

  • Communications
  • Conference paper
  • First Online:
Mathematical Foundations of Computer Science 1989 (MFCS 1989)

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 379))

  • 148 Accesses

Abstract

Let A be a set of n points in the Euclidean plane. We would like to know its symmetry group. Since in a computer points can be represented by rational coordinates only, the problem in the original way degenerates to a trivial case. This is why we introduce the notion of approximate symmetry. In our model we consider a fixed tolerance factor ɛ and ask for the set A′ consisting of n points of the ɛ-neighborhoods of the points in A, each point of A′ belonging to a different point of A, with maximal symmetry group. A similar concept has been developed for approximate congruence recently and several efficient algorithms are known for that related problem. In this paper we obtain the surprising result that the decision problem for approximate symmetry is NP-hard.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Helmut Alt / Kurt Mehlhorn / Hubert Wagener / Emo Welzl: Congruence, Similarity, and Symmetries of Geometric Objects, Discrete Comput. Geom. 3 pp.237–256, 1988

    Google Scholar 

  2. Mikhail J. Atallah: Checking Similarity of Planar Figures, International J. Comp. Inf. Science 13 pp. 279–290, 1984

    Google Scholar 

  3. Mikhail J. Atallah: On Symmetry Detection, IEEE Trans. Comput. 34 pp. 663–666, 1985

    Google Scholar 

  4. M. D. Atkinson: An Optimal Algorithm for Geometrical Congruence, J. Algorithms 8 pp. 159–172, 1987

    Google Scholar 

  5. M. E. Dyer / A. M. Frieze: Planar 3DM is NP-Complete, J. Algorithms 7 pp. 174–184, 1986

    Google Scholar 

  6. Michael R. Garey / David S. Johnson: Computers and Intractability — A Guide to the Theory of NP-Completeness, Freeman, 1979

    Google Scholar 

  7. P. T. Highnam: Optimal Algorithms for Finding the Symmetries of a Planar Point Set, Information Processing Letters 22 pp. 219–222, 1986

    Google Scholar 

  8. Sebastian Iwanowski: Linear Time Algorithms for Testing Approximate Congruence in the Plane, Proceedings of the Workshop on Graph Theoretic Concepts 88, Lecture Notes in Computer Science 344, pp. 213–228

    Google Scholar 

  9. David Lichtenstein: Planar Formulae and their Uses, SIAM J. Comp. 11,2 pp.329–343, 1982

    Google Scholar 

  10. Pierre Rosenstiehl / Robert Tarjan: Rectilinear Planar Layouts and Bipolar Orientations of Planar Graphs, Discrete Comput. Geom. 1 pp.343–353, 1986

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Antoni Kreczmar Grazyna Mirkowska

Rights and permissions

Reprints and permissions

Copyright information

© 1989 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Iwanowski, S. (1989). Testing approximate symmetry in the plane is NP-hard. In: Kreczmar, A., Mirkowska, G. (eds) Mathematical Foundations of Computer Science 1989. MFCS 1989. Lecture Notes in Computer Science, vol 379.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-51486-4_76

Download citation

  • DOI: https://doi.org/10.1007/3-540-51486-4_76

  • Published:

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-51486-2

  • Online ISBN: 978-3-540-48176-8

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ics